数据库设计在网站开发中的应用
2019-10-21宋龙坤曹昌旭徐振方王梦霞
宋龙坤 曹昌旭 徐振方 王梦霞
摘 要:数据库技术是目前计算机领域中发展最为迅速的技术之一,在现代网络环境中具有广阔的应用市场,也是网站开发管理中的关键性技术类型。网站开发中需要根据网站的运行特点和需求科学设计数据库作为网站开发的技术支持,科学合理的数据库设计是保证网站稳定且高效运行的关键,本文针对数据库设计和网站开发相关概念和技术展开描述,探讨了数据库设计在网站开发中的实际应用。
关键词:数据库设计;网站;开发管理;实际应用
1.数据库概念
计算机网络技术的发展与应用使计算机技术成为当前社会不可或缺的一种技术,网站作为现代企业和市场推广的重要手段之一,是展示企业文化的重要方式,而数据库技术则是现代网络开发中的关键技术,其设计质量关系到网站的运营维护的便捷性和稳定性。现代网络信息技术的发展衍生出了大量的信息数据,而数据库技术就是在网络信息技术的发展下进一步发展起来的技术,运用数据库技术能够对网络运行中的大数据进行有效的整理和分析,从大数据中获得可靠的信息资源。如今数据库技术已经趋向成熟,但随着网络信息技术发展和社会发展需求的不断提高,对数据库处理技术的要求也随之增加。在数据库技术的基础上,网站可以对海量的数据信息进行轻松、有效地整理和分析,从大数据中快速获得所需信息,帮助用户更加快捷的浏览所需内容。
数据库技术就是将网络中的数据进行整合,利用数据库可以实现网络信息的管理和存储。网站开发过程包括设计不同的模块,一般内部管理网站的不同模块之间的关联性低,因此设计数据库之前要根据设计需求和网站的开发运行要求进行分析,详细合理的需求分析能够为开发稳定、高效的网站提供技术支持,设计数据库时应充分考虑网站维护以及运营中的相关问题,提高网站运营的稳定性和可靠性。
2.数据库设计要求
2.1数据库设计的基本原则
用户的设计需求在数据库设计环节中需要充分考虑,程序员设计数据库前要综合考虑数据库设计方向和内容,把握用户的需求可以提高数据库设计的科学性和有效性。由于网站开发中可能发生一些未知问题,所以设计开始之前要根据网站基本的要求和可能产生的意外进行改善,为网站开发做好充足的准备。
2.2数据表字段设计
根据网站开发需求设计数据表字段的类型,确定数据表字段的最小数据,按照最优设计目标,可以将各个基础信息进行分裂,实现资源信息的最优化处理。
2.3数据表的设计要求
数据表是数据库设计的主要环节,由于用户需求的不同,数据库设计内容和环节也有着一定的差别,但是数据库的设计环节和网站开发具有紧密的关系,网站运行要求具备一定的拓展性能和多样性,能够满足不同客户需求,因此需要将网站设计内容划分为不同的需求模块,建立数据表时需要将网站资源充分的储存在数据表中,以提高网站数据存储性能。设计数据表时需要依据网站需求来完善数据表信息,依据网站的功能有指向性的创建数据表以完善网站设计内容。
3.数据库设计在网站开发中的应用分析
网站开发前首先要明确开发目的和服务对象,根据目的及服务对象的差异分析需要建立的模块,一般遵循简约、便捷、独特的设计原则,同时应避免网站资源浪费。
3.1数据库设计在网站前台开发中的应用
网站前台开发是网站开发阶段的重要环节,用户对网站前台的印象和使用效果的好坏直接关系到后期的网站推广和宣传效果,因此网站前台设计应该重点考虑整体布局和模块分类,合理的前台布局能够使用户更加清晰直观的浏览。用户常浏览的网站内容包括网站首页信息、各栏目信息等内容,网站的页面信息来自于数据库中存储的数据,数据库设计可以根据网站前台开发需求自行设计网站前台页面内容,在数据库设计的基础上根据用户的网站使用需求定制相关的网站内容,用户浏览网站时网站前台会生成相关的数据文件,然后将浏览数据整合、存储,数据库设计要根据所有的数据信息进行分类处理,实现数据信息批量化管理,提高数据库的数据存储空间。
3.2数据库设计在网站后臺开发中的应用
网站的后台管理工作由网站管理人员负责,通过对网站内部板块内容的管理实现网站内容的更新、删减和页面维护,网站的后台开发工作内容主要包括了网站权限设置、栏目管理、插件管理和信息管理等内容,开发阶段设置的网站权限管理主要包括页面复制粘贴权限、管理员设置以及其他相关内容的管理工作,而网站信息管理主要包括页面的信息更新、删减和修改等,插件管理主要包含了网站的首页管理、模块管理和信息栏目管理等板块内容的增加和删减。
4.数据库设计在网站应用中效果分析
数据库设计在网站开发应用中具有很高的灵活性和便捷性,为网站开发提供了更加灵活高效的页面设计,由于数据库的支持,网站无需建立多个静态页面就可实现网站的拓展和更新。在数据库设计的基础上,网站开发可在前台和后台管理的基础上对网站进行管理和完善。
网站开发之前需要考虑网站的更新和整改,现代社会信息更新速度快,不论是企业网站宣传还是优化,都会对网站信息进行大幅修改。数据库设计基础上可以对网站后期维护和更新提供便利,网站管理人员只需在网站后台设置好相关的网站页面,添加相应的内容标题即可实现网站更新,具有极高的灵活性和便捷性。
5.结语
当前处于网络社会,大量的网络数据和信息急速膨胀,用户使用网站时包括检索、删减以及分类等基本需求,同时包含了大量的用户个人数据,在数据库设计的支持下,网站开发可以满足更多用户的需求,快速更新网站内容,提升了网站运行速度和运行安全。数据库设计可以满足现代网络开发的需求,支持建立大型的网站建设工作,提高网站开发效率和重复使用率。
参考文献:
[1] 董剑利;黄应堂. 数据库网站技术的发展和应用.
[2] 曾志明. 网站开发技术的比较研究
作者简介:
宋龙坤,男,河南鹿邑人,本科,山东协和学院计算机科学与技术专业学生。
曹昌旭,男,1998年11月,山东东营人,本科,山东协和学院计算机科学与技术专业学生。
徐振方,男,1999年6月,山东菏泽人,本科,山东协和学院计算机科学与技术专业学生。
王梦霞,女,指导教师,通讯作者,硕士,副教授。